Griffith was a swift right fielder with one of the best arms in the NL. He was consistently
in double figures in assists and topped 20 three times. A favorite with Dodger fans
from 1919 to 1924, he was an occasional .300 hitter. His best all-around year was
1921, when he hit .312 with a dozen homers and drove in 71 runs for Brooklyn.
